Marsha Fitzalan/Lady Marcia Mary Josephine Fitzalan Howard is a British actress best known for her portrayal as Sarah B'Stard in The New Statesman. She is the third daughter of Miles Fitzalan-Howard, 17th Duke of Norfolk, and Anne Fitzalan-Howard, Duchess of Norfolk. She trained at the Weber Douglas Academy and apart from The New Statesman, has appeared in Upstairs, Downstairs, The Professionals and Murder Most Horrid.
